Subscribers 3.1K
#Science & Nature
drama/snark page for Emma and Maggie MacDonald (PLUS RELATED INFLUENCERS) **this is a SNARK page, do NOT report posts/comments unless it…
Created is May 14, 2026
1
-2
11.0K
0
There is not enough data yet
There is not enough data yet